Arborist Pruning in Reno, NV
Arborist p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of trees to promote health, safety, and aesthetic appeal. This service covers a variety of projects, including removing dead or diseased branches, reducing the size of overgrown trees, and shaping trees for better growth and appearance. Homeowners often request pruning to prevent potential hazards from falling branches, improve sunlight exposure, or enhance the overall look of their landscape.
Before requesting arborist pruning, property owners should consider the specific goals for their trees, such as improving health, safety, or visual appeal. It is also helpful to understand the type of trees on the property and any particular concerns, like proximity to structures or power lines. Proper pruning techniques are essential to ensure the long-term vitality of the trees and to avoid damage, making it important to work with experienced professionals who understand the needs of different tree species.

Common Arborist Pruning Jobs
Tree Crown Thinning - reduces weight and improves airflow to promote healthier growth.
Structural Pruning - shapes trees to maintain stability and prevent potential hazards.
Deadwood Removal - eliminates dead or diseased branches to enhance tree health.
Formative Pruning - guides young trees to develop a strong, balanced structure.
Emergency Pruning - addresses storm damage or broken branches to reduce safety risks.
Fruit Tree Pruning - encourages better fruit production and overall tree vigor.
Arborist Pruning Questions
What is arborist pruning? Arborist pruning involves trimming and shaping trees to promote health, safety, and aesthetic appeal on residential and commercial properties.
Why is pruning important for trees? Proper pruning helps remove dead or hazardous branches, improves tree structure, and encourages healthy growth.
What types of pruning services are available? Services include crown thinning, crown reduction, deadwood removal, and formative pruning to suit different tree needs.
When is the best time to prune trees? The ideal time for pruning varies by tree species, but generally, late winter or early spring is suitable for many types before new growth begins.
